EDC Minutes <br /> March 18, 2005 Not Approved, <br /> Page 3 <br /> • Henk from Paster Enterprises. Backman presented correspondence regarding the Hardee's <br /> Restaurant building. The conversion to Caribou Coffee(western end of the building)represents <br /> a sizeable investment on Paster's part. Backman also distributed to the members building <br /> schematics showing the renovated building. Paster was able to get a settlement with Hardee's <br /> for$150,000(Hardee's had a ground lease until 2011). Henk asked for financial assistance from <br /> the City as part of this project. Backman inquired about building valuations—the old value was <br /> estimated to be $50 a sq. ft., and the new value $130 a sq. ft. Henk indicated that from the <br /> 1/18/05 letter to the 2/25/06 project costs increased from $376,000 to $517,000. Entsminger <br /> asked about the higher costs. Henk indicated that while they would be able to save the slab, <br /> utilities, mechanical systems, curb and paving,the renovation costs were coming in higher. Field <br /> asked about the payback calculations. Henk responded saying it was based upon the difference <br /> in rent. Backman asked about other potential users of the building, and noted that in other <br /> projects the City has participated in site clearance activities or in stormwater management <br /> activities. Henk provided some cost estimates for demolition, excavation, landscaping. Ericson <br /> indicated that the City could contact RCWD about potential ponding changes and if there could <br /> be overflow to the road right-of-way. Backman asked about the financial gap needed. Henk <br /> indicated that the gap was at least$125,000. Backman will discuss the numbers with Field and <br /> other EDC members and come back to the next EDC meeting with more information. <br /> 7.
